Act as the primary HR representative for the designated business function, supporting all employee life cycle HR processes in collaboration with business stakeholders.
Manage employee engagement programs, performance management, talent acquisition, L&D operations, HR operations, policy compliance, and grievance management to enhance employee experience and ensure uniform HR practices across geographically dispersed locations.
Provide timely identification and escalation of employee risks and concerns, collaborate with business leaders on HR matters, and support HR MIS, audit requirements, and data-driven decision making.
